The VALUE COLLECTION 581807P is a hex socket cap screw designed for high-strength fastening applications in industrial, mechanical, and structural assemblies. It features a 1-8 UNC thread size with full threading along its 1.5-inch length under the head. The 3/4-inch hex drive accepts a standard hex key or Allen wrench for installation. Constructed from alloy steel with a black oxide coating, this fastener delivers solid tensile strength and moderate corrosion resistance. It meets ASME/ANSI B18.3 and ASTM A574 dimensional and mechanical standards, making it a reliable choice for precision fastening work across a range of industrial settings.
This screw is suited for machine assembly, jig and fixture work, tooling, and general industrial maintenance where a socket-drive cap screw is required. The 1-8 UNC coarse thread pitch allows for quick engagement and is well-matched to standard tapped holes in steel, cast iron, and similar ferrous materials. The black oxide finish reduces light reflection and provides light surface protection in dry or mildly corrosive environments. Machinists, maintenance technicians, and fabricators working in manufacturing or production environments will find this fastener fits common assembly requirements.

Installation is performed using a 3/4-inch hex key or Allen wrench; ensure the drive tool is fully seated before applying torque to avoid rounding the socket. Confirm that the mating tapped hole is clean, free of debris, and threaded to 1-8 UNC specification before installation. De-energize and lock out any machinery before replacing or installing fasteners on operating equipment. Follow applicable facility or equipment manufacturer guidelines for fastener seating procedures.
